Sanskriti University admissions are ongoing. To get admission, candidates must have to meet the minimum eligibility criteria set by the university for various offered courses. The university accepts various entrance exams for admission such as CUET UG, JEE Main, CUET PG, Sanskriti University National Admission Test (SUNAT), MAT, CAT, XAT, NMAT, etc. For admission to the UG courses, candidates must have passed class 12 from a recognised board with a minimum of 45% marks in the relevant stream. Entrance exams like CUET, UG, JEE Main, NEET UG are accepted for admission to the UG courses. To become eligible for the PG courses, candidates must have a graduate degree in the relevant stream from a recognised university. Entrance exams like CUET PG, SUNAT, MAT/ CAT, NMAT, XAT, and NAT are accepted by the university for PG admission at Sanskriti University.
Various scholarships are also offered to the candidates based on their merit, economic background and more. There are a total of 26 courses offered by the university in different specialisations. To apply for admission to the offered courses, candidates must apply online through the official website or you can also visit the admission office of the university to submit the duly filled application form in offline mode.

Sanskriti University scholarships are offered according to applicants' performance in the qualifying or competitive exams, or their CGPA. These programmes, which range from the Chancellor's Scholarship Scheme to those created for particular groups including MBA students, athletes, and girl students, show the university's commitment to encouraging academic excellence and inclusion. Sanskriti University encourages eligible students to continue higher education with a sense of purpose and drive by providing financial aid. Scholarships from Sanskriti University encourage students to succeed and make the most of their academic careers in addition to relieving financial burdens.
| Courses | % of Marks in 12th Class (Or Equivalent) | Scholarship percentage on the yearly tuition fee |
| B.Tech | 75% - 80.99% | 10% |
| 81% - 85.99% | 25% | |
| 86% - 90.99% | 50% | |
| 91% and above | 100% | |
| B.Tech 2nd Year | 8.6 - 8.8 CGPA | 20% |
| 8.81 - 9.0 CGPA | 40% | |
| 9.01 - 9.29 CGPA | 50% | |
| 9.3 CGPA & Above | 100% |
